Transaction 7d8a2e8c59537a2badf39dea020f6b768d92a5364576511fa6201284e9ceceec
1 Input
1 Output
-
7d8a2e8c59537a2badf39dea020f6b768d92a5364576511fa6201284e9ceceec:0
- value
- 140843
- script pubkey
- OP_0 OP_PUSHBYTES_20 f346eb5c0c291c8f8638c2e71a19216136ab0bbd
- address
- bc1q7drwkhqv9ywglp3cctn35xfpvym2kzaa5shw2p